Italy - Veneto Thermal Baths Bike Tour 2018 Individual Self-Guided 7 days / 6 nights The long history of the spa resorts in Abano and Montegrotto starts with the ancient cult of Aponus, god of thermal waters with healing qualities. Just like two thousand years ago, these places dedicated to wellbeing, immersed in the natural park of the Euganei hills, are still the ideal destination for a healthy, relaxing break.

Day 6: Praglia and Villa dei Vescovi round tour 35 km An easy itinerary takes you to the celebrated Benedictine abbey in Praglia, founded in the 11th century and now a center of excellence for the restoration of antique books. The itinerary continues towards the majestic Villa dei Vescovi, designed in the 16th century. A few hours can be spent while visiting the interiors and enjoying a picnic in the gardens. You will stop in the gardens of Villa Barbarigo in Valsanzibio, one of the most important examples of the classical Italian garden and the medieval towns of Arquà Petrarca and Monselice. Day 3: Padua round tour 35 km A country road will take you to the unique Villa Emo Capodilista, now also a prestigious wine estate. Following the Bacchiglione River you will come to Padua. Spend the afternoon discovering its wonders, such as the Scrovegni Chapel, frescoed by Giotto, and a UNESCO World Heritage Site, the Basilica of St Anthony, the Prato della Valle square, Andrea Mantegna s frescoes and the prestigious university founded in 1222.
